如何评估云原生系统的可观测性?

云原生可观测性

一、定义可观测性的关键指标

在评估云原生系统的可观测性时,首先需要明确可观测性的关键指标。这些指标通常包括:

  1. 日志:记录系统运行时的详细信息,用于故障排查和性能分析。
  2. 指标:量化系统性能的数据,如CPU使用率、内存占用等。
  3. 追踪:记录请求在系统中的流转路径,帮助理解系统行为。

二、日志管理与分析

日志管理是可观测性的基础。在云原生系统中,日志管理面临以下挑战:

  1. 日志收集:如何高效地从分布式系统中收集日志。
  2. 日志存储:选择合适的存储方案,确保日志的可访问性和持久性。
  3. 日志分析:利用工具进行日志分析,提取有价值的信息。

解决方案
– 使用集中式日志管理系统,如ELK Stack(Elasticsearch, Logstash, Kibana)。
– 实施日志轮转和压缩策略,优化存储空间。
– 利用机器学习算法进行日志异常检测。

三、监控与告警机制

监控与告警机制是确保系统稳定运行的关键。在云原生系统中,监控与告警机制需要考虑:

  1. 监控范围:覆盖系统各个组件,包括基础设施、应用和服务。
  2. 告警策略:设置合理的告警阈值,避免误报和漏报。
  3. 告警响应:建立快速响应机制,确保问题及时处理。

解决方案
– 使用Prometheus和Grafana进行监控和可视化。
– 实施多级告警策略,根据严重程度采取不同响应措施。
– 定期审查和优化告警规则,提高告警的准确性。

四、分布式追踪技术

分布式追踪技术帮助理解请求在系统中的流转路径。在云原生系统中,分布式追踪技术面临以下挑战:

  1. 追踪粒度:如何确定追踪的粒度,平衡信息量和性能开销。
  2. 数据关联:如何将不同服务的追踪数据关联起来,形成完整的请求路径。
  3. 可视化:如何将追踪数据可视化,便于分析和理解。

解决方案
– 使用Jaeger或Zipkin进行分布式追踪。
– 实施统一的追踪ID,确保数据关联性。
– 利用追踪数据的可视化工具,如Kibana或Grafana。

五、用户体验监测

用户体验监测是评估系统可观测性的重要方面。在云原生系统中,用户体验监测需要考虑:

  1. 用户行为:如何收集和分析用户行为数据。
  2. 性能指标:如何监测和优化系统性能,提升用户体验。
  3. 反馈机制:如何建立有效的用户反馈机制,及时发现问题。

解决方案
– 使用Google Analytics或Mixpanel进行用户行为分析。
– 实施性能监控工具,如New Relic或AppDynamics。
– 建立用户反馈渠道,如在线调查或用户访谈。

六、安全性和合规性检查

安全性和合规性检查是确保系统可观测性的重要环节。在云原生系统中,安全性和合规性检查需要考虑:

  1. 数据安全:如何确保日志和监控数据的安全性。
  2. 合规性:如何满足相关法律法规的要求,如GDPR。
  3. 审计:如何实施有效的审计机制,确保系统操作的透明性。

解决方案
– 实施数据加密和访问控制,确保数据安全。
– 定期进行合规性审查,确保符合相关法律法规。
– 使用审计工具,如AWS CloudTrail或Azure Monitor,记录系统操作。

通过以上六个方面的评估,可以全面了解云原生系统的可观测性,并采取相应的措施进行优化和改进。

原创文章,作者:IT_learner,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/107050

(0)
上一篇 4天前
下一篇 4天前

相关推荐

  • 高效沟通底层逻辑与心理学有什么联系?

    高效沟通与心理学的联系 在当今复杂多变的商业环境中,沟通能力成为企业成功的关键因素之一。理解沟通的底层逻辑与心理学的联系,能够帮助企业管理者和员工更高效地传达信息,提高工作效率。本…

    2024年12月11日
    66
  • 商业智能软件市场中的主要竞争者有哪些?

    商业智能软件市场中的主要竞争者概览 在企业信息化和数字化转型的过程中,商业智能(BI)软件是不可或缺的工具。它们帮助企业收集、分析和可视化数据,以支持决策制定。当前市场上,商业智能…

    2024年12月11日
    44
  • 有色金属产业链的关键环节有哪些?

    > 有色金属产业链涉及从矿产勘探到回收利用的多个环节,每个环节都有其独特的技术挑战和市场需求。本文将详细探讨矿产勘探与开采、矿物加工与冶炼、金属精炼与合金制造、产品成型与深加…

    2024年12月28日
    1
  • 光量子计算机的优缺点有哪些?

    光量子计算机作为一种前沿技术,正在逐步进入人们的视野。本文将从基本原理、优缺点、应用场景、技术挑战及未来发展方向等多个维度,深入探讨光量子计算机的现状与前景。通过对比分析,帮助读者…

    3天前
    2
  • 如何应用战略性绩效管理第四版的理论?

    战略性绩效管理第四版为企业提供了系统化的管理框架,帮助企业实现战略目标与日常运营的高效衔接。本文将从战略目标设定、KPI确定、绩效评估、员工激励、组织结构优化及风险管理六个方面,结…

    2天前
    7
  • 寻找股权价值评估公司要注意哪些问题?

    在寻找股权价值评估公司时,企业需要关注多个关键因素,包括评估公司的资质与信誉、评估方法与模型的选择、行业经验和专业知识、数据来源的可靠性和透明度、费用结构和性价比,以及客户反馈和服…

    6天前
    1
  • 机器学习的定义与数据挖掘的区别在哪里?

    机器学习与数据挖掘是当今企业信息化和数字化中的两大热门技术,但它们常常被混淆。本文将从定义、区别、应用场景、潜在问题及解决方案等方面,深入探讨两者的异同,帮助企业更好地理解并应用这…

    2天前
    2
  • 如何制定项目绩效评价验收标准?

    制定项目绩效评价验收标准是企业信息化和数字化管理中的关键环节。本文将从确定项目目标、定义绩效指标、选择评估方法、设定验收流程、识别风险以及确保沟通有效性六个方面,结合实际案例,为您…

    6小时前
    0
  • 哪些企业已经在河南应用区块链技术?

    本文探讨了河南省区块链技术的应用现状,列举了已应用区块链技术的企业案例,分析了不同行业中的区块链应用场景,并总结了企业应用区块链技术时遇到的挑战及解决方案。最后,文章展望了未来发展…

    1天前
    0
  • 如何实施gjb9001c-2017质量管理体系要求?

    本文旨在探讨如何有效实施GJB9001C-2017质量管理体系要求。文章将从标准概述、体系规划与设计、文件和记录控制、内部审核与管理评审、持续改进与纠正措施以及特定行业应用中的挑战…

    1天前
    1